How to dress like a Jesmond Student

18/11/24

Have you ever been strolling down Osborne Road and thought, ‘Wow there’s a certain look to students who live here, how do I dress like that?’. Well look no further, your step-by-step guide is here.

This week I took to the streets (specifically Acorn Road), to find out what the Jesmond massive are actually wearing, and what they think about trends amongst their peers in the area. We got all the fit-checks and trend reports so you don’t have to.

A few facts stood out to me; the skinny scarf is more alive than ever, but has tough competition with the blanket scarf making a huge comeback east of the metro line. If you don’t own any Newcastle or Poly sports merchandise you may as well just go home now, and is anyone doing anything about the astonishing number of men’s bare legs out mid December?

But seriously, sports merch is rife in Jesmond, whether it’s going to the pub or nipping to Local, Canterbury’s will be your best friend and see you through exam season. If rugby kit isn’t your vibe, flared yoga trousers appear to be the top alternative, for the clean-girl 9am warrior.

The overall tone, gathered from Jesmond’s resident students is that they value comfort most of all, sports wear and Birkenstocks are a go-to. And there’s always the option to dress it up if you’re planning a pub crawl down Osbourne Road, comfortable and chic!
